Pollack (Pollock)
Fish
A slim, bronze-to-olive fish with a protruding lower jaw and a curved lateral line that dips sharply below the front dorsal fin — the easiest way to tell it apart from coalfish.
Facts
- 'Pollack' and 'Pollock' are the same species (Pollachius pollachius) — just two spellings in common use across different regions.
- A hard-fighting light-tackle target, especially over rough or kelpy ground on lures worked with a jigging retrieve.
- Stocks in some UK waters have declined sharply, prompting emergency conservation measures in recent years.
UK fishing rules
MCRS is 30cm. Since 2023 a recreational bag limit of one pollack per angler per day has applied in several UK sea areas (including west of Scotland, the Irish Sea, Celtic Sea and English Channel) following steep stock declines — confirm the current limit for your area before keeping fish.
